## 📖 Overview
**Neon-Burp Pro** is a lightweight, asynchronous security auditing framework designed for rapid web application assessment. It combines the power of traditional intercepting proxies with a modernized, API-driven Neon interface. Built for speed, efficiency, and deep-dive analysis.

## 🛠️ Core Modules

### 1. 🛡️ Vulnerability Research Engine
Equipped with a proprietary scanning logic to detect:
- **Injection Flaws:** SQLi (Error-based & Blind), RCE, and LFI.
- **Cross-Site Scripting:** Reflected XSS detection via parameter analysis.
- **Security Misconfigurations:** Missing HSTS, CSP, and X-Frame-Options.

### 2. 💣 Advanced Intruder (Fuzzer)
A high-speed fuzzing engine for directory discovery and parameter brute-forcing. 
- Supports custom payloads and wordlists.
- Real-time status code and response size monitoring.

### 3. 🔄 Request Repeater & Forge
A dedicated environment for manual request manipulation.
- Full control over HTTP headers, cookies, and body data.
- Instant response rendering for rapid debugging.

### 4. 🔐 Crypto-Toolkit (Decoder)
On-the-fly encoding and decoding support:
- Base64, URL Encoding, Hex, and MD5/SHA hash identification.

## 🚀 Quick Start

### Installation
Ensure you have Python 3.10+ installed.

$ git clone https://github.com/Amjad-Purple/Nburp.git
$ cd Nburp
$ pip install -r requirements.txt

### Deployment
$ python3 Nburp.py

The dashboard will be initialized at: http://127.0.0.1:5000

## 🏗️ Technical Architecture
Nburp Pro operates on a decoupled architecture:
- **Backend:** Python/Flask RESTful API handling the security logic.
- **Frontend:** Responsive Neon-CSS UI using Vanilla JS for real-time data fetching.
- **Engine:** Requests-based HTTP client with SSL/TLS verification bypass for internal auditing.
